I about fell out of bed this morning when I watched this amazing video on YouTube of a very bright young man named Param Jaggi who has invented a way to reduce CO2 emissions from the tail pipe of all automobiles, right now. His invention is called the Ecotube and it’s all explained in this fabulous video.

What a breath of fresh air to see amazing commitment from such a young entrepreneur who may just give our climate a fighting chance. Here is how Dan Sietz of UPROXX describes Jaffi’s magnificent invention, ” Jaggi uses layers of algae on plates arranged in a tube; when you start your car, emissions flow over it… including the CO2 we need out of the atmosphere. The algae turn the CO2 into oxygen, and even the least fuel efficient vehicle has become far more green.”
